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48277950356 33622 730 77854 90135
2456333830 25005
2456333830 25005
610 95 7481488343 42468024
All about undefined
Interested in learning more?
2456333830 25005
610 95 7481488343 42468024
See more
65200754 098
12998 6295145 9089090 338
See more
030628055 951098954
26021 2067707 6247991929 803 39
See more